3030 env :
3131 RUSTC_BOOTSTRAP : 1
3232 steps :
33- - uses : act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.2
33+ - uses : act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4.1.4
3434 - uses : dtolnay/rust-toolchain@master
3535 with :
3636 toolchain : ${{ env.RUST_TOOLCHAIN_VERSION }}
@@ -53,16 +53,16 @@ jobs:
5353 continue-on-error : ${{ matrix.checks == 'advisories' }}
5454
5555 steps :
56- - uses : act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.2
57- - uses : EmbarkStudios/cargo-deny-action@b01e7a8cfb1f496c52d77361e84c1840d8246393 # v1.6.2
56+ - uses : act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4.1.4
57+ - uses : EmbarkStudios/cargo-deny-action@3f4a782664881cf5725d0ffd23969fcce89fd868 # v1.6.3
5858 with :
5959 command : check ${{ matrix.checks }}
6060
6161 run_rustfmt :
6262 name : Run Rustfmt
6363 runs-on : ubuntu-latest
6464 steps :
65- - uses : act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.2
65+ - uses : act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4.1.4
6666 - uses : dtolnay/rust-toolchain@master
6767 with :
6868 toolchain : ${{ env.RUST_TOOLCHAIN_VERSION }}
8080 run : |
8181 sudo apt-get update
8282 sudo apt-get install protobuf-compiler krb5-user libkrb5-dev libclang-dev liblzma-dev libssl-dev pkg-config
83- - uses : act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.2
83+ - uses : act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4.1.4
8484 with :
8585 submodules : recursive
8686 - uses : dtolnay/rust-toolchain@master
9191 with :
9292 key : clippy
9393 - name : Run clippy action to produce annotations
94+ # NOTE (@Techassi): This action might get a new release sonn, because it
95+ # currently uses Node 16, which is deprecated in the next few months by
96+ # GitHub. See https://github.com/giraffate/clippy-action/pull/87
9497 uses : giraffate/clippy-action@13b9d32482f25d29ead141b79e7e04e7900281e0 # v1
9598 env :
9699 GITHUB_TOKEN : ${{ secrets.GITHUB_TOKEN }}
@@ -109,7 +112,7 @@ jobs:
109112 name : Run RustDoc
110113 runs-on : ubuntu-latest
111114 steps :
112- - uses : act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.2
115+ - uses : act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4.1.4
113116 - uses : dtolnay/rust-toolchain@master
114117 with :
115118 toolchain : ${{ env.RUST_TOOLCHAIN_VERSION }}
@@ -128,7 +131,7 @@ jobs:
128131 - run_rustdoc
129132 runs-on : ubuntu-latest
130133 steps :
131- - uses : actions/checkout@b4ffde65f46336ab88eb53be808477a3936bae11 # v4.1.2
134+ - uses : act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4.1.4
132135 - uses : dtolnay/rust-toolchain@master
133136 with :
134137 toolchain : ${{ env.RUST_TOOLCHAIN_VERSION }}
0 commit comments